Hundreds attend Eagle Fest as students return to the EMU campus post pandemic

Two days into the first on-campus semester since the pandemic, students enjoy meeting each other on the university green outside of Eastern Michigan University’s Student Union. They gathered for EagleFest 2021, which is an opportunity for student organizations to recruit new members. (Photos by Emma Adkins)
